Overview

Tailwind UI is an impressive utility-first CSS framework that allows developers to create stunning UI components effortlessly. As someone with a background in backend development using Laravel, I am excited to experiment with Tailwind CSS and its free, open-source components. The clean design and flexibility of Tailwind UI are perfect for elevating any web application without compromising on performance.

This project leverages Laravel 7 alongside Tailwind CSS, creating a seamless environment for building responsive and modern user interfaces. The ability to integrate Alpine.js adds interactivity, making it a robust choice for developers looking to enhance their frontend capabilities.

Features

  • Utility-First Approach: Tailwind CSS allows for rapid design implementation through utility classes, making the styling process both efficient and intuitive.
  • Open Components: Access to a variety of free and open-source Tailwind UI components means you can build beautiful interfaces without any additional costs.
  • Seamless Laravel Integration: Built on Laravel 7, this project benefits from a powerful backend framework, enhancing overall performance and security.
  • Easy Installation: Setting up the project is straightforward; simply clone the repository and run a few commands to get started.
  • Responsive Design: Tailwind CSS components are inherently responsive, ensuring that your application looks great on all devices.
  • Customization Options: Tailwind’s configuration file allows for extensive customization, making it easy to align with your design requirements.
  • Interactive Features via Alpine.js: Integrating Alpine.js brings interactivity to your components without the overhead of larger frameworks, maintaining a lightweight footprint.
